JOB SUMMARY:

The Benefits Account Manager is responsible to assist clients through the annual benefits renewal process and year-round delivery of the agency's value proposition. This includes, but is not limited to the pre-renewal meeting, renewal strategy and open enrollment facilitation. Successful candidates will demonstrate a superb work ethic, high level of motivation and strong team working skills by routinely collaborating with all internal teams on specific client needs.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BLILITIES:

  • Prepare and edit correspondence, communications, presentations, spreadsheets and other documents
  • File and retrieve documents and reference materials
  • Conduct research, assemble and analyze data and complete project-based work
  • Assist in the completion of applications and spreadsheets 
  • Establish and maintain effective working relationships with co-workers, clients and vendors
  • Review and explain insurance policies, benefit options and premium strategies
  • Keep records of customer interactions and transactions, recording details of inquiries, complaints, and comments, as well as actions taken throughout the year 
  • Local travel for client meetings and on an as needed basis
  • Attend client meetings with or without broker
  • Conduct open enrollment meetings
  • Arrange and coordinate meetings and events
  • Monitor, respond to and distribute incoming communications
  • Answer and manage incoming calls
